These little banjos are so much fun for me to play! With an 8” rim and 17” scale, you wouldn’t think they could sound their best playing in the same range as the regular banjo,. but it works! (with special strings, of course). I appreciate the long sustain and slightly dusty tone that comes from the Cherry. This one is made from Cherry from the Carpenter Ant Stash in Portland and Pistachio from California Orchards. Check out the little Sprout inlay in the headstock, very cute!
